World Tour mode, an open world with a hint of RPG

First of all, we must mention the mode World Tour, the big novelty of this opus. Here, players will be led to create their own custom avatar before embarking on the exploration of a vast open world. Indeed, we can walk the streets of Metro City, Nayshall and other emblematic places of the saga.

The World Tour mode, comparable to a Story mode, will also include some RPG elements. It will for example be possible to improve the stats of his character by using objects or food, but also by modifying his wardrobe.

As you gain experience, you can then spend points in various skill trees to unlock additional moves and special attacks.

But that’s not all. During his journey, the player can meet the 18 fighters who make up the game’s roaster. By giving them gifts and completing certain missions for them, you can strengthen your bonds of friendship and learn their respective techniques and special moves. Then it’s up to you to create a hybrid character using the attacks of Ryu, Ken and Chun-Li.

The Battle Tour, the new multiplayer arena

Once you’ve mastered World Tour mode, Battle Hub Mode awaits you to participate in online battles against custom avatars of players around the world.

Versus, Team Battle and Extreme Battle modes are also in the game, while it will be possible to create your own rooms with personalized rules that can accommodate up to 16 players.

Ranked Matches will also be available upon release.. For the occasion, Capcom has made some adjustments to “reduce the pressure of losing a match at certain levels”. For example, rookies won’t lose league points for losing while Iron-Gold and Master rank players won’t suffer league demotion. Moreover, each character will have their own league rankwhich allows you to try different fighters without fear of losing your ranking in case of defeat.

Better accessibility

In order to make its Street Fight 6 accessible to as many people as possible, Capcom has multiplied the options:

  • the sound design has been reworked to allow hearing-impaired players to obtain various information (distance between the opponent, height of attacks, remaining amount of life and Super gauge, etc.) through specific sounds
  • Complete tutorials and character guides
  • Dynamic control modewhich makes it easy to unleash the most demanding moves and combos

New characters announced and a demo!

Capcom has already planned to add 4 new characters this year with the introduction of Rashid (Street 5), AKI (fall 2023), Akuma (from spring 2024) and Ed (winter 2024).

And finally, last good news, a playable demo is available now on PS4 and PS5. It will be necessary to wait until April 26, 2023 for Xbox Series X/S and PC players. You will be able to discover the basic mechanics of combat and shape your avatar. You can also transfer it to the full game as soon as it is released on June 2, 2023.
